Output f653838de8deff356d02fda8a766eda0b15ea83d77ffcefdf82498fd7e2bbf92:0

value
42227006
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4cd08233cf680fa5310bc379071b0bc949ccfa5a OP_EQUALVERIFY OP_CHECKSIG
address
181A91dSu8g9NskBedn2vPUT4U4ZWAatuq
transaction
f653838de8deff356d02fda8a766eda0b15ea83d77ffcefdf82498fd7e2bbf92
confirmations
522693
spent
true